Pole Variety - Sunset Runner Pole Bean is a vigorous, climbing heirloom variety known for its stunning ornamental and edible qualities. The plants produce an abundance of soft pink flowers that attract pollinators, followed by long, tender pods. These beans are excellent for fresh eating, cooking, or canning, offering a sweet, nutty flavor. Sunset Runner Pole Beans thrive in full sun and well-drained soil, maturing in about 65-70 days. This dual-purpose plant adds vertical interest to gardens and trellises, providing both visual appeal and a bountiful harvest of nutritious, versatile beans.
